Dallas Cowboys NFL 2015 roster: Dez Bryant might make comeback against Seahawks

Dallas Cowboys wide receiver Dez Bryant in 2010. Wikimedia Commons/AJ Guel

The Dallas Cowboys may have their star wide receiver Dez Bryant back as he is expected to play in their Week 8 game against the Seattle Seahawks, according to a report by Fox Sports.

Bryant suffered a foot injury in the first game of Dallas' 2015 season against the New York Giants last September 13.

The day after, he went through surgery which made him miss action in their past five games, with the team currently riding a four-game losing streak.

But earlier this week, Bryant already returned to practice and was participating in 11-on-11 drills, according to ESPN.

Still, the 26-year-old receiver has a questionable status against Seattle but expressed his desire of playing only if he was to make that decision.

"If I play, I'm not thinking about nothing. I'm playing. Dez is Dez out there. If I'm thinking, I'll remove myself from the situation. So we're going to just see," Bryant also said.

In the past three seasons, Bryant has not missed a regular season game for the Cowboys and last season played one of his best years in the National Football League (NFL) having 88 receptions for 1,320 yards and a career-best 16 touchdowns.

That is what the struggling Cowboys are missing this season along with the absence of franchise quarterback Tony Romo who suffered a collarbone injury in Week 2.

If Bryant returns against the Seahawks, he will be working with current starting quarterback Matt Cassel.

Cassel replaced quarterback Brandon Weeden, who first started in place of Romo but failed to bring success to the Cowboys.

Even Cassel have struggled in his first start last Sunday in their 27–25 defeat to the Giants, completing 17-of-27 passes for 227 yards, one touchdown, and a notable three interceptions.

The return of Bryant will be big for the Cowboys whose playoff hopes this season are dwindling because of all the setbacks they have experienced.
